Quality Inn in Dundee, Michigan is a comfortable and convenient lodging option for travelers looking for a relaxing stay. Located at 111 Waterstradt Commerce Drive, this hotel offers a range of amenities including free breakfast, a fitness center, and an indoor pool. The rooms are clean and spacious, providing a cozy atmosphere for guests to unwind after a long day of exploring the nearby attractions. "It was a good experience. The rooms were quite large. Very good for the price. The only bummer is they don't have a hot tub. Otherwise good experience and great price."
"Girlfriend and I stayed this past weekend and left with bed bug bites all over our bodies. Staff at first was only offering a $100 refund but after discussion gave us back a full refund. Staff confirmed maintenance found bugs inside our room. Regardless of receiving a full refund, it doesn’t change the fact we left with bed bug bites. I don’t recommend this hotel!!"
"Wonderful stay! Was told it's under management and it really seems to be working. Front desk was really friendly and helpful. They gave me great direction and must sees in Dundee. Was able to take time to enjoy the pool. Finally a pool that was not to cold to enjoy. They had something for everyone to enjoy for breakfast. Definitely will be staying here again when I travel through."
"If you're looking for a place to sleep for the night this would suffice. Good location. The room decor is outdated but that is never my top concern. However having lights is and there unfortunately weren't any light bulbs over our sink/vanity. We called down to front desk and they said they would bring some up but they never did and by the time we got back from the game we didn't care. We were just getting up and leaving in the morning. The queen beds seem small but from what i could tell they were bug free. I did discover what looked to be dried up snot/boogers on the top blanket as i was getting into bed. I just tried to not think about it. The front desk staff was very nice and gave me a great tip to always call the hotel directly to book your room. We booked thru the offical website several weeks before and when I called the day of to confirm our arrival she said they were overbooked and that it was a good thing I was coming in early. I would hate to be the last 4 people who checked in later to discover they had no place to sleep. Breakfast had individually wrapped muffins and breakfast sandwiches as well as bagels, and waffles. Water and coffee. I passed on the bowl of overripe Bananas. Maybe they'll make banana bread with them. Overall I am glad my stay was just 1 night. The price was about $130."
